Transaction 99caa32167235e36fa12758645e4fc24272415583d59ccee4e0b9c79828449c6
1 Input
1 Output
-
99caa32167235e36fa12758645e4fc24272415583d59ccee4e0b9c79828449c6:0
- value
- 108382089
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 27d637ee86fe6cae7f909c77edc197c273cd3d67 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14ddyeGY2f3HZqRFsU6iRS6BWzbZYekPw5